Modern Art and Art Moderne

The post-modernist foreground building is the San Francisco Museum of Modern Art (SFMOMA), designed by Mario Botta and built in 1995 The building behind is part of the Pacific Telephone and Telegraph Building. This art moderne building was built in 1925.

Pointing Skywards

The Transamerica Pyramid and Columbus Tower - iconic San Francisco architecture. The tower was built between 1905-1907 and is one of the few surviving pre-earthquake buildings in the city center. It is owned by Francis Ford Coppola. The pyramid, designed by William Pereira, is 260m high and was built in 1972. It has not always been well loved by the citizens of San Francisco.
